In-Person vs Online Lessons
In-person lessons are the gold requirement. The very best piano lessons are hands-on, and students are encouraged to make a personal commitment. However, if you are interested in taking lessons online, there are many things to think about.
Numerous online music classes are expensive. If you desire a good fundamental grounding in music terminology and playing method, online lessons are a viable alternative. Besides, they can be hassle-free if you do not have time to commute to your teacher’s home.
Online courses also give you the ability to skip lessons. This can be helpful if you are an excited learner who wishes to get to the next level quick. But it’s important to recognize that you should keep up with your research.
In-person lessons likewise have the advantage of being more personalized. You can ask concerns, and you can develop a close relationship with your instructor. That means you can gain from mistakes, and they can correct technical problems in your playing.
Taking piano lessons personally is more expensive than taking them online. It can also disrupt your schedule, if your child is in school. Unless you have a great deal of versatility, it can be difficult to arrange a lesson on the weekends.
Among the most essential factors for taking in-person lessons is to see a live demonstration of your playing. For example, you can see how your fingers work, and what sort of posture you should adopt. Getting this sort of feedback is the best method to advance as a pianist.
